Furthermore, what does the man in black want Westworld?
The Man in Black says he's been visiting Westworld for over three decades, and wants to visit the deeper levels of the game, which he believes are hidden in the park. He says he regularly visits Dolores Abernathy, a host who lives on the outskirts of Sweetwater. He is also acquainted with Teddy Flood and Lawrence.
Furthermore, is the Man in Black William Westworld? William, also known as the Man in Black or Billy, is portrayed by Ed Harris and by Jimmi Simpson as a young man. He was a reluctant first-time visitor to Westworld, joining his future brother-in-law, Logan Delos. He later became a rich, sadistic Westworld guest searching for a "deeper level" in the park.

How good is the LeMat revolver?
It's a pretty good gun although I prefer the Schofield for PvP. The LeMat has only slightly higher damage than the Schofield, higher ammo capacity (9 rounds versus 6 rounds) and the ability to fire 1 shotgun shell. The Schofield is better in every other way so ultimately it's down to looks.

"Man in Black" (or "The Man in Black") is a protest song written and recorded by singer-songwriter Johnny Cash, originally released on his 1971 album of the same name. Cash himself was known as "The Man in Black" for his distinctive style of on-stage costuming.What episode do you find out who the man in black is?
